NORMAL, ILL. – Illinois State Swim and Dive opened its two-day meet with UNI in strong fashion Friday, winning six of ten events to open the meet. The Redbirds lead 97-89 heading into Day Two of the meet.
HIGHLIGHTS
-
The Redbirds opened the meet with a 1-2 sweep of 3M as Eva Reyes took first with a mark of 264.15 while Gaby Russell's score of 262.88 was good for second place.
-
Illinois State split Friday's relay races, taking first in the 400y Medley Relay. Chloe Tyler, Madyson Morse, Mia Snow and Ella Turken turned in a mark of 3:51.30 for the win.
-
Diana Walker opened her final home meet as a Redbird with a 200y Freestyle win and time 1:54.06. She was one of three Redbirds to win events in the pool.
-
Madyson Morse also took a win to open her last meet at Horton Pool, going 1:05.80 in the 100y Breaststroke.
-
Sophomore Giulia Basco earned first in the 200y Butterfly with a mark of 2:06.50. Cassidy Carey made it a 1-2 sweep for Illinois State as her 2:11.39 took second.
The Redbirds honor their seniors and close the meet tomorrow with 1M Dive beginning at 9 AM.
